For the first time in their history, Russia qualify for the Rugby World Cup Finals.
Wins for Russia and Georgia in this weekend’s round of European Nations Cup matches means that these two teams have all but secured their qualification to the 2011 Rugby World Cup.
Russia took a giant step towards qualification for the Rugby World Cup by edging Portugal 14-10 in a tense encounter in Sochi this weekend.
We preview the 2010 Rugby European Nations Cup season. Both Russia and Georgia have a great chance of winning the title, and qualifying for the 2011 Rugby World Cup.
